Abstract:
A method and associated systems improve access time of a federated repository that represents a set of individual data repositories as a virtualized aggregated repository. An analyzer module counts the number of entries in each individual repository that are associated with each possible value of a selected concordance parameter. The analyzer stores these counts in a Concordance Frequency Table. When the federated-repository manager receives a data-access request, the analyzer associates the requested data element with a corresponding value of the concordance parameter. The analyzer then uses information stored in the Table to select an optimal sequence in which the federated-repository manager should search the repositories for the requested data. This optimal sequence orders the repositories such that the first repositories to be searched will be those that contain the greatest number of entries associated with the concordance-parameter value of the requested data.
